CPSC Recall in 2022: Crate and Barrel Recalls Be the Band Music Sets Due to Choking and Suffocation Hazards

Recall Number: 22-095
Date: March 09, 2022
Product Name: Be the Band Music Sets
Recall Description:

This recall involves the Crate and Barrel Be the Band Music Set containing maracas which is intended for use by children ages three and up. The set includes a table about 19 inches in height by 26 inches wide with drum pads and sticks, cymbals, maracas and xylophone keys. The product SKU: 346895 is located on a label on the underside of the table.  

Hazard Description:

The maracas can break or become unscrewed and release the metal beads inside, posing choking and suffocation hazards to young children.

Remedy Type:

Refund

Units:  About 620
Incidents:

Crate and Barrel has received six reports of broken or unscrewed maracas. No injuries have been reported.

Sold At:

Online at www.crateandbarrel.com from September 2021 through January 2022 for about  $200.

Manufactured In:

China
